one small question inline, otherwise this one LGTM On January 23, 2026 8:56 am, Kefu Chai wrote: > Previously, cephadm's build process pulled dependencies from PyPI, > which failed in environments with restricted network access. This > change backports upstream improvements that enable building cephadm > using system packages instead, mirroring the existing RPM packaging > workflow. > > And the vendored Arrow pulled xsimd from GitHub, this also failed in > building environment without network access. This change backports > upstream improvements enabling the build to use libxsimd-dev package > when building debian packages. > > Backported changes: > - https://github.com/ceph/ceph/pull/66256 - Use
